Smart Shopping: What to Watch for in Red Sarees Under 1700

Here’s how to make sure your saree feels luxe, even on a budget:

  • Fabric choice: Georgette and art silk give that coveted flow and sheen, while remaining lightweight—ideal for long hours of wear at events.
  • Colour saturation: Look for deep, rich reds—avoid pale or patchy dye jobs, which can age the saree quickly. A vivid red catches the light and camera beautifully.
  • Border detailing: Opt for sarees with contrast borders, subtle zari, or printed edges. These touches add visual interest and elevate the saree without heavy embroidery costs.
  • Pallu design: A well-finished pallu, even if simple, makes your drape look polished. Check for neat tassels, digital prints, or a pop of metallic threadwork.
